MUMBAI: Bangalore-based mobile VAS company OnMobile has posted 82 per cent drop in its net profit for the quarter ended 31 March, 2012 as its expenses jumped 38.85 per cent.
The company has posted a net profit of Rs 47.9 million for the last quarter of the fiscal, as against a net profit of Rs 268.5 million in the year ago.
Onmobile’s income from operations grew 33.18 per cent to Rs 1.78 billion, compared to Rs 1.33 billion in the preivous year.
However, the expenses also surged to Rs 1.62 billion, from Rs 1.17 billion in the corresponding quarter of the previous fiscal. This was mainly because its spend on content fee and royalty jumped to Rs 248.4 million, from Rs 137.5 million in the year ago. The company also continued investments towards geographical expansion in Latin America, North America and Africa.
The company’s Ebitda (ear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ortization) increased 33 per cent to Rs 413 million, from Rs 309 million.
